API Name: Stereotypes – Get Details
Overview
This API returns stereotype metadata for a given UML metatype and list of stereotypes.
MBSE Core uses this API to:
Retrieve stereotype definitions
Retrieve tagged value (tag) definitions
Validate tag data during element creation and update
Support dynamic modeling capabilities
Connector responsibility:
For the given
metaTypeandstereotypes:Load stereotype definitions from the end system.
Resolve stereotype IDs if required.
Fetch tag definitions associated with those stereotypes.
Convert the response into
MbseStereotypeformat.Return consistent and complete stereotype metadata.

Behavior Rules
The response must be scoped to:
projectIdmetaType
Only the requested stereotypes must be returned.
If
expandTags = true:Include tag definitions (
tagDefinitions) for each stereotype.
If
expandTags = false:Return stereotype identifiers without tag definitions.
Connector must:
Resolve stereotype IDs internally.
Map end system tag metadata to
MbsePropertyMeta.
If no matching stereotypes are found:
Return an empty list.

Supported Data Types
The dataType field may contain:
TEXTHTMLWIKIMARKDOWNLOOKUPDATE_STRINGBOOLEANNUMBERUSERNAME_AS_USEREMAIL_AS_USERTIME_UNIT
If TIME_UNIT is used, the timeUnit value must be one of the following:
SECONDSMINUTESHOURSDAYS

Implementation Guidelines
Resolve stereotype IDs using end system API.
Map end system tag definitions accurately.
Ensure no duplicate tag definitions are returned.
Maintain consistent data type mapping.
Avoid returning unrelated stereotype definitions.
Keep response deterministic.
Design Rationale
Stereotypes define semantic extensions in UML/SysML models.
This API ensures:
Accurate stereotype discovery
Proper tag validation
Safe element creation and updates
System-agnostic metadata abstraction
By separating stereotype metadata from element metadata, the MBSE SDK maintains clean architectural boundaries and dynamic modeling flexibility.
